The invention provides a rotary lock control method for a container single-container lifting appliance. The method comprises the following steps: when a rotary lock control system is started, an internal state switch of a monitoring module is detected, the monitoring module with the switch at the ON position is taken as a first monitoring module, and a state sensor corresponding to the first monitoring module is taken as a first state sensor; a second monitoring module judges the theoretical working condition of a second state sensor through a second judging method, and meanwhile, the second monitoring module judges whether the second state sensor has an abnormal condition or not through a third judging method; a third monitoring module judges the theoretical working condition of a third state sensor through a fourth judging method; meanwhile, the third monitoring module judges whether the third state sensor has an abnormal condition or not through a fifth judging method; and the firstmonitoring module judges the theoretical working condition of the first state sensor through a sixth judgment method, the above steps are repeated and finally the cyclic control of a rotary lock is achieved.
